Although Whitlocks End may not boast a ticket office, the station ensures that ordering and collecting your tickets is hassle-free with available ticket machines. Travelers are encouraged to purchase tickets online and collect them upon arrival. While the station does not feature smartcard services, it does offer essential support facilities including customer help points and the use of induction loops. Moreover, it prioritizes security with CCTV systems in place, making safety a paramount feature. Travelers with accessibility concerns will be pleased to know that Whitlocks End provides step-free access with ramp provisions, although some areas may require venturing via the street between platforms.
The station is accredited by the Secure Station Scheme, ensuring commuter confidence in its safety and security measures. For any inquiries, the Contact Centre team is ready to assist via phone during their operating hours. However, for immediate assistance, attracting a Conductor's attention on the platform is advisable for those needing aid when boarding trains.

The ticket facilities at West Hampstead Thameslink are designed to cater to every traveler’s needs. The ticket office operates from early morning to late evening, providing convenience for those early commutes or late-night returns. For tech-savvy travelers, ticket machines are readily available, offering the capability to collect tickets purchased online. Moreover, advanced systems like smartcard issuance and validation are in practice, ensuring a swift transition from station to train.
The station boasts step-free access throughout, making it accessible for everyone, including those with mobility issues. Assistance can be pre-booked or availed on arrival, ensuring that every passenger experiences a smooth journey. Though the station lacks accessible toilets and waiting rooms, its commitment to accessibility is evident, with induction loops, ramps for train access, and seating areas abundantly available.
Ensuring optimal convenience, West Hampstead Thameslink is well-integrated with diverse transport links. With accessible entry and exit points and customer help points, getting to and from the station is smooth. While there is no provision for cycle hire, the station offers 42 bicycle storage spaces fitted with CCTV for added security.
